About Assisted LivingAssisted living facilities offer housing and care for active seniors who may need support with activities of daily living, like bathing, dressing, and medication management.Complete guide to assisted livingBest of 2026 Assisted Living Winners
About Memory CareMemory care facilities provide housing, care, and therapies for seniors who have Alzheimer’s disease or other forms of dementia in an environment designed to reduce confusion and prevent wandering. Complete guide to memory careBest of 2026 Memory Care Winners
About Independent LivingIndependent living facilities offer convenient, hassle-free living in a social environment for seniors who are active, healthy, and able to live on their own.Complete guide to independent livingBest of 2026 Independent Living Winners
About Senior LivingSenior living is a term used to describe various housing and care options for older adults from maintenance-free, 55+ facilities for active seniors, to secure, fully staffed facilities for seniors with Alzheimer's or dementia. Cost of memory care in Brocton, IL

The average cost of senior living in Illinois is $7,681 per month as compared to $6,999 in the United States.

Senior living costs in Illinois vs. national costs

Cost comparison table showing community type costs by location. This table contains 3 rows of data across 4 columns.
Column communityType: Community type
Column state: Illinois
Column national: U.S.
Column costDifference: Cost difference
Community typeIllinoisU.S.Cost difference
Memory Care$7,681/mo$6,999/mo9.7% above national median
Assisted Living$6,329/mo$5,830/mo8.6% above national median
Independent Living$3,342/mo$3,520/mo5.1% below national median
